SPCA Pick Your Price Adoption Event Set June 25

Your red carpet treatment awaits! The SPCA will be holding an adoption event while hosting the Aflac Grammy’s Mobile Experience on Monday, June 25th from 9 am to 1 pm.  During this event, adopters can pick their price on all dogs, cats, puppies, kittens, pigeons, doves, rabbits, guinea pigs, hamsters, rats, chickens, and, of course, ducks!

Come enjoy this free and fun musical experience, which includes red carpet photographs, Grammy museum artifacts, Guitar Hero, an interactive musical wall, a VIP music lounge, and more – and maybe fall in love, too! Coffee will be available for purchase from Castle Rock Coffee from 8 to 10 am and you can purchase lunch from Tacos don Beto from 11 am  to 1 pm. There will also be drawings and prizes!

The SPCA for Monterey County is located at 1002 Monterey-Salinas Highway, across from WeatherTech Raceway at Laguna Seca.  This event will start at 9am and end at 1pm.

SPCA cat and dog adoptions include the pet’s spay or neuter surgery, permanent microchip identification, vaccinations, SPCA ID tag, a health evaluation, and more. Regular adoption fees range from $35 to $290.

The SPCA for Monterey County is your nonprofit, independent, donor-supported humane society that has been serving the animals and people of Monterey County since 1905. The SPCA is not a chapter of any other agency and does not have a parent organization.  They shelter homeless, neglected and abused pets and livestock, and provide humane education and countless other services to the community. They are the local agency you call to investigate animal cruelty, rescue and rehabilitate injured wildlife, and aid domestic animals in distress. Online at www.SPCAmc.org.
